This product is a high precision & Input/Output Rail-to-Rail monolithic ICs integrated single independent CMOS Op-Amps on a single chip. It features low input offset voltage, low noise and low input bias current. It is suitable for automotive requirements such as engine control unit, electric power steering, anti-lock braking system, sensor amplifier, and so on.
Power supply (Min.) [V] (+5V=5, +/-5V=10)
2.5
Power supply (Max.) [V] (+5V=5, +/-5V=10)
5.5
Channel
1
Circuit Current (Typ.) [mA]
0.645
Input Offset Voltage (Max.) [mV]
0.55
Input Bias Current (Typ.) [nA]
0.0005
Slew Rate (Typ.) [V/µs]
2
Input Voltage Range [V]
VSS to VDD
Output Voltage Range [V]
VSS+0.015 to VDD-0.025
Voltage gain (Typ.) [dB]
137
Equivalent input noise voltage (Typ.) [nV/√Hz]
8
Output current (Typ.) [mA]
50
CMRR (Typ.) [dB]
100
PSRR (Typ.) [dB]
95
GBW (Typ.) [MHz]
4
Operating Temperature (Min.) [°C]
-40
Operating Temperature (Max.) [°C]
125
Package Size [mm]
2.9x2.8 (t=1.25)
Common Standard
AEC-Q100 (Automotive Grade)
